Listed below are some of the problems and the possible solutions. 

General Problems

Possible Solutions

The device cannot take 

photos or record videos

• 

Ensure that the SD card is formatted 
properly and inserted correctly.

• 

Use the recommended type of SD card 
(minimum 8GB Class 10)

The device automatically 

stops when recording
Video is unclear

Ensure that there are no fingerprints or dirt on 

the lens. Ensure that the lens is always kept 

clean.

Dark images while 

recording water/sky

Adjust the exposure setting.

Colour of the images is 

not good

Set the ‘white balance’ setting to automatic.

Cross-stripe interference 

in an image

This is due to the light frequency. Change the 

light frequency depending on the light source.

The device crashes/

freezes

Press the ‘Reset’ button, with a pin, to restart 

the device.

SD Card Error

Please format the SD card and use 

recommended card only. Please make sure 

the SD card is recommended dash cam use.

Display turns off after a 

few minutes

Please check the LCD Auto Off setting and 

select Always On. 

Memory card is full

Please allow loop recording to overwrite 

older recording files or delete unwanted files 

including emergency recordings. 

Camera feels warm 

during operation

It is normal for the camera to get warm during 

operation. Please bear in mind that the if the 

camera is exposed to high temperature for 

a long period of time, it might fail to boot up. 

Cool it down and try again.

The recorded video 

doesn’t show mapping 

information on the 

GpsTracker Player.

Please ensure the PC is connected to internet.
